Local knowledge
Timing is Everything
For major sites like Chichén Itzá and Tulum, arriving shortly after opening or a few hours before closing can significantly reduce exposure to the midday sun and the largest tour groups. This strategy enhances the experience, making the visit more comfortable and visually rewarding.
Hydration is Key
The Yucatan Peninsula's climate is warm year-round. Always carry ample water, especially when visiting archaeological sites or spending time outdoors. Dehydration can quickly turn a pleasant day into a difficult one, impacting your ability to enjoy your chosen activities.
Beyond the Resorts
While resorts offer convenience, venturing out to sites like Xel-Há or Xcaret Park provides a deeper connection to the region's natural and cultural heritage. These experiences often become the most memorable aspects of a trip to Cancun.
Tips before you go
Book excursions in advance
Popular tours and park tickets sell out, especially during peak season, and pre-booking often secures better prices.
Pack light, breathable clothing
Comfort is crucial in the tropical climate, allowing you to move freely whether exploring ruins or enjoying water activities.
Carry insect repellent
Mosquitoes can be prevalent, particularly in natural areas and during dawn and dusk, to prevent bites.
Learn basic Spanish phrases
While English is widely spoken in tourist areas, knowing a few phrases enhances interactions with locals and shows respect.
